Space Market Uptake in Europe

This study shed light on the potential applicability of data acquired from the EU Galileo and Copernicus satellite systems in both the public and private sector and on the reasons why such potential remained largely underutilised. The regulatory framework, market characteristics and policy actions regarding space data were comprehensively analysed. The study relied on extensive consultation of policymakers, space agencies, the space industry and different categories of space data users selected across the EU and various work environments (such as the academia, non-governmental organisations and the business world). Case studies on applications based on satellite data for commercial use have been developed. The study derived conclusions about the main bottlenecks in using the EU space data and recommendations on the policy actions deemed more urgent and virtually effective to remove those barriers.
